Horton 9 rounds for time with a partner of: 9 bar muscle-ups 11 clean and jerks, 155 lb. 50-yard buddy carry Share the work with your partner however you choose with only one person working at a time. If you can’t find a partner, perform 5 reps of each exercise per round and find a heavy sandbag to carry. The mainsite published a partner workout two weeks ago. In the past, athletes have expressed to me that they don’t prefer partner workouts because they worry that they won’t contribute as much as their partner in the completion of the workout. But, in most partner workouts, it is specified that each partner, working one at a time, performs whatever amount of work that they can, and then athletes trade off. The result, is that each athlete does a percentage of the workout that challenges them. If one athlete is faster or stronger than...

Taken from CrossFit Catacombs website:  An article in the Washington Post inspired this post. The article and link to it are here: New study says 30 minutes of exercise a day is not enough. You should double or quadruple that. A study was published this week in the journal Circulation (worth noting this is not Vanity Fair or Men’s Health; actually a journal by and for cardiologists) which suggests that the American Heart Association (AHA) should revise its long-held recommendation of 30 minutes of exercise per day. On the surface, this is an interesting finding. Basically we can further reduce our cardiac risk factors by exercising more. But upon digging deeper, there is more to...
